Jodi Wille


Jodi Wille is an American filmmaker, book publisher, curator and film programmer known for her work exploring American subcultures.

Wille directed and produced The Source Family (2012), her first feature-length documentary, with Maria Demopoulos. The film, which explores the rise and fall of the eponymous 1970s Los Angeles utopian community, premiered in competition at South by Southwest Film Festival in March 2012 and sold out screenings there and at several other major festivals.The Source Family was released theatrically to 60 cities in May 2013 through Drag City Film Distribution and online through Gravitas Ventures.

In 2016, Wille premiered "We Are Not Alone," a documentary short about The Unarius Academy of Science.

In 1993, R.E.M. gave Wille her first paid directing gig for their "Find the River" music video. Signed to DNA (David Naylor & Associates), she directed a number of music videos in the mid-90s. Wille worked prior to that as assistant to music video and commercial director Samuel Bayer and later as assistant and development consultant to feature film director Roland Joffé.

As a photographer in the 90s, Wille worked with a number of musicians and artists including Sparks (band), Vincent Gallo, Melissa Etheridge, and the Dwarves.

In 1998, Wille co-founded Dilettante Press (with Steve Nalepa, Nick Rubenstein, and Hedi El Kholti), a now defunct publishing house with a focus on self-taught, visionary, and vernacular art and photography. Dilettante only published three titles, but "their impact was considerable."

In 2005, Wille and her then-companion Adam Parfrey of Feral House founded Process Media, with an emphasis on non-fiction, literary memoirs, and illustrated books exploring subcultures and groundbreaking artists such as Andy Kaufman, Roky Erickson and the 13th Floor Elevators, John Sinclair and MC5, Ya Ho Wa 13 and Father Yod, and Moondog. Process has also created a "Self-Reliance Series" of illustrated guide books that promote sustainable and self-sufficient living.
